  • Denotes those present at the exit meetin . Licensee Action on Previous Inspection Findings (Closed) Open Item (155/84006-02): Recalibrate charcoal geometries by September 1, 1984. This item remained open after inspection 50-155/85017 comparisons resulted in disagreements for this geometry. Although the licensee had recalibrated, the disagreements were due to differences in activity distribution between the actual sample and the calibration standar The licensee again recalibrated the charcoal geometry after investigating various analytical techniques which would assure reliable results. The calibration was verified to be accurate based on examination of data and the comparison results, in which all agreements on both detectors 1 and 2, listed in Table 1 were obtaine . Environmental Protection The inspector examined the 1984 and 1985 annual Radiological Environment Monitoring Report which contained the licensee's voluntary program of particulate and radiciodine air sampling, lake and well water, aquatic biota and sediment, milk, and the single Technical Specifications (T/S)

requirement of film or TLD monitoring. No unusual trends appeared to be attributable to plant opp ation The inspector reviewed the new Radiological Environmental Monitoring l l Program (REMP) which was required to be implemented effective January 1, '

1986, and the licensee's Environmental Contractor's monthly results for January through May 1986 to assure compliance with the program. The inspector pointed out differences between the old and new program descriptions, typically used in the annual report, and stressed that (1) an accurate version be used and that (2) T/S 6.9.2.1 and T/S 13. be consulted for the details required in the annual report and the Offsite Dose Calculation Manual (0DCM).

Confirmatory Measurements Sample Split Fire samples (air particulate, charcoal, liquid waste receiver tank, gas and reactor coolant) were analyzed for gamma emitting isotopes by the licensee and in the Region III mobile laboratory onsit All samples were analyzed on both detectors 1 and 2 except for the gas and reactor coolant samples which were only analyzed on detector Results of the sample comparisons are listed in Table 1; comparison criteria are given in Attachment 1. The licensee achieved a total of 50 agreements out of 51 comparison The lone disagreement, Xe-133 in the gas sample, was examined as were the results of the other nuclides and the gas results obtained during the inspection conducted in September 1985. The comparison for Xe-133 in 1985 was also technically a disagreement but the criterion was relaxed to compensate for nonuniform thickness between the bottoms of glass sample vials which produces different attenuation of tle 81 key energy lin However, further examination of the 1986 ref ults indicated that except for Kr-88 the results are conservatively biased and the ratios of the licensee's results to the NRC results increase with decreasing energy. This relationship and the fact that the gas geometry was calibrated with a liquid containing mixed radionuclides indicates that the bias is caused by a lack of self absorption corrections for the various energie The licensee agreed to determine a suitable standard to be purchased and calibrate gas geometries within two weeks after the receipt of the standard, bearing in the mind the possible need for self absorption correction (0 pen Item 155/86013-01).

A dirty waste receiver tank (DWRT) was sampled and split to test the licensee's liquid release geometry. The initial sample, counted before dilution and filtration, indicated the presence of Sn-113 in both the licensee and NRC portion; however, this nuclide was not present in the licensee's liquid library and therefore was not identified or quantifie Although this nuclide was not present in the sample when filtered (see L WASTE on Table 1) which is more representative of a release sample, the licensee agreed to add it to appropriate libraries and job streams (0 pen Item 155/86013-02).

The licensee further volunteered to review his release libraries for any other missing nuclides. The licensee also agreed to analyze a portion of the DWRT for gross beta, H-3, Sr-89, and Sr-90 and report the results to Region III (0 pen Item 155/86013-03).

The inspector examined Chem tank and DWRT batch release data from January 15 through July 19, 1986, which includes gamma spectrographic analyses, for the presence of Sn-113. No evidence of the presence of Sn-113 in any release was foun QA/QC of Analytical Measurements The licensee conducts a proceduralized QC program for a gamma spectrometer, two gas proportional counters (one currently out of service) and a well counter in the counting room. Results of required daily tests are recorded in two log books. Test results beyond the QC tolerance are circled in red; a second test performed and supervision informed if appropriate. The inspector reviewed entries in these log books and found that tests are being performed as required, entries beyond a tolerance noted and comments of actions taken logge The backup / emergency gamma spectroscopy system (detector 2), used for the sample split analyses (Section 4a), is located in the air compressor room in an extremely warm environmen It is normally left unpowered and is only source tested and energy calibrated prior to us The inspector discussed the need for routine testing of this system and providing a more suitable environment. The licensee acknowledged the inspector's comments and agreed to perform a monthly source test on this system and an energy calibration if required (0 pen Item 155/86013-04).

ATTACHMENT 1 CRITERIA FOR COMPARING ANALYTICAL MEASUREMENTS

.

_This attachment provides criteria for comparing results of capability tests and verification measurements. The criteria are based on an empirical relationship which combines prior experience and the accuracy needs of this progra In these criteria, the judgment limits are variable in relation to the com-parison of the NRC's value to its associated one sigma uncertainty. As that ratio, referred to in this program as " Resolution", increases, the acceptability of a licensee's measurement should be more selective. Conversely, poorer agreement should be considered acceptable as the resolution decreases.
